Iron Maiden returns to Toronto on their “Somewhere Back In Time” World Tour. The set list will be pure 80’s, with a stage design recalling the Powerslave tour.
A few people were surprised when I told them that the show is entirely sold out; they wondered if Iron Maiden were “really” that popular. Indeed they are. Old school metal has been making a huge comeback for years, and since reforming with Bruce Dickinson (thee Bruce Dickinson) on vocals in 1999, Iron Maiden have been consistently getting better. For fans, the bands last three studio albums (2000’s “Brave New World”, 2003’s “Dance of Death, and 2006’s “A Matter of Life and Death”) are considered to be essential pieces of their history, while their live shows are intense, anthemic, and loud.
